"""Firepup650's PYPI Package"""
import os, sys, termios, tty, time
import random as r
import fkeycapture as fkey
from collections import Sequence
def clear() -> None:
"""# Function: clear
Clears the screen
# Inputs:
None
# Returns:
None
# Raises:
None"""
os.system("clear")
def cmd(command: str) -> int:
"""# Function: cmd
Runs bash commands
# Inputs:
command: str - The command to run
# Returns:
int - Status code returned by the command
# Raises:
None"""
status = os.system(command)
return status
def randint(low: int = 0, high: int = 10) -> int:
"""# Funcion: randint
A safe randint function
# Inputs:
low: int - The bottom number, defaults to 0
high: int - The top number, defaults to 10
# Returns:
int - A number between high and low
# Raises:
None"""
try:
out = r.randint(low, high)
except:
out = r.randint(high, low)
return out
def e(code: any = 0) -> None:
"""# Function: e
Exits with the provided code
# Inputs:
code: any - The status code to exit with, defaults to 0
# Returns:
None
# Raises:
None"""
sys.exit(code)
def gp(keycount: int = 1, chars: list = ["1" ,"2"], bytes: bool = False) -> str or bytes:
"""# Function: gp
Get keys and print them.
# Inputs:
keycount: int - Number of keys to get, defaults to 1
chars: list - List of keys to accept, defaults to ["1", "2"]
# Returns:
str or bytes - Keys pressed
# Raises:
None"""
got = 0
keys = ""
while got < keycount:
key = fkey.getchars(1, chars)
keys = f"{keys}{key}"
print(key,end="",flush=True)
print()
if not bytes:
return keys
else:
return keys.encode()
def printt(text: str, delay: float = 0.1, newline: bool = True) -> None:
"""# Function: printt
Print out animated text!
# Inputs:
text: str - Text to print (could technicaly be a list)
delay: float - How long to delay between characters, defaults to 0.1
newline: bool - Wether or not to add a newline at the end of the text, defaults to True
# Returns:
None
# Raises:
None"""
# Store the current terminal settings
original_terminal_settings = termios.tcgetattr(sys.stdin)
# Change terminal settings to prevent key interruptions
tty.setcbreak(sys.stdin)
for char in text:
print(char, end='', flush=True)
time.sleep(delay)
if newline:
print()
# Restore the original terminal settings
termios.tcsetattr(sys.stdin, termios.TCSADRAIN,original_terminal_settings)
def sleep(seconds: float = 0.5) -> None:
"""# Function: sleep
Calls `time.sleep(seconds)`
# Inputs:
seconds: float - How long to sleep for (in seconds), defaults to 0.5
# Returns:
None
# Raises:
None"""
time.sleep(seconds)
def rseed(seed: any = None, version: int = 2) -> None:
"""# Function: rseed
reseed the random number generator
# Inputs:
seed: any - The seed, defaults to None
version: int - Version of the seed (1 or 2), defaults to 2
# Returns:
None
# Raises:
None"""
r.seed(seed, version)
def robj(sequence: Sequence[object]) -> object:
"""# Function: robj
Returns a random object from the provided sequence
# Input:
sequence: Sequence[object] - Any valid sequence
# """
r.choice(sequence)
